Ashby de la Zouch Museum provides an insightful look into the town's history, featuring a variety of displays, artefacts and historical documents. Trace the town's development through old photographs, maps, and letters, making it an ideal stop for those interested in local heritage. Managed by volunteers, the museum hosts regular events such as antique valuations and exhibitions. With over 3,000 photographs and a range of artefacts, history enthusiasts are treated to a rich experience. Located on North Street, the museum is open most days, with varying hours, and reservations are recommended for special events.
